Which city is known for its vibrant street art scene and has become a popular destination for art enthusiasts?

  1. Berlin

  2. London

  3. New York City

  4. Tokyo


Correct Option: A
Explanation:

Berlin is renowned for its diverse and dynamic street art scene, attracting visitors from around the world to explore its urban art galleries and outdoor murals.
